## Build provenance — Spoolerette

Heads up for the sync: every Spoolerette image now carries a provenance attestation from the Calloway build farm. No more mystery binaries on the print tier — if it wasn't built by the farm, the spooler refuses to boot it. To verify an artifact by hand, compare it against the trace token recorded below.

session token of tajef-bageg = htk21_5d90d574934f3ccae6437

# Runbook: Hunting leaked file descriptors in Quillgate

When the `fd_open` gauge climbs steadily between deploys, suspect a leak rather than load. First confirm on a single pod: exec in and count entries under `/proc/1/fd`, noting how many are sockets in CLOSE_WAIT versus regular files. Capture two snapshots ten minutes apart before restarting anything — we need the delta for the postmortem. Reproduce locally with the Marbury load harness, which requires the service running with the following configuration values.

settings of yagep-bajog:
[istdor]
port = 4000
region = south-2
host = istdor.qorvelcorp.internal
timeout_ms = 5000
retries = 5

## Deploying the Gatewick Proctor Queue

Deploys are pretty painless: push to main, wait for the pipeline, then watch the queue drain dashboard for five minutes. If candidates pile up mid-exam, roll back first and ask questions later — the queue replays safely. Everything the workers care about lives in one config block, shown here for reference.

settings of bafof-yagef:
JOROX_PIN=8740
JOROX_TENANT=pelox
JOROX_METRICS_HOST=metrics.jorox.qorvelworks.internal
JOROX_SEAL=seal_c78f63c1
JOROX_STANDBY_TEAM=norax